Los excesos del mono: salvajismo, transgresión y deshumanización en el pensamiento nahua del siglo xvi
Of the many symbolisms attributed to the monkey among the ancient Nahuas those related to excess and transgression stand out, as these qualities characterize for the most part the essence of this mammal.
